Hattonchatel château
History

Hattonchatel is named after the 9th century bishop of Verdun, who built a palace on a rocky promontory overlooking the Seille Valley. Unfortunately Cardinal Richelieu had parts of the building destroyed in 1634, The cheatu in winterbut just after the first world war, Belle Skinner, an American lady, fell in love with the village and helped

The restored buildingrestore the château and the ancestral

history of the region. What you find now is a charming village with many interesting sights located in the magnificent Seille Valley with the château at its centre.
